Brick restoration services involve repairing, cleaning, and restoring brickwork to improve both the appearance and structural integrity of a property. Over time, bricks can become stained, cracked, or deteriorated due to exposure to weather, pollution, or age. Professional brick restoration focuses on removing dirt, moss, and efflorescence, as well as fixing damaged or crumbling bricks to ensure the building remains stable and visually appealing. This process helps preserve the original character of a property while addressing issues that could lead to more costly repairs if left unattended.

Many common problems signal the need for brick restoration. These include visible cracks or crumbling mortar joints, efflorescence (white salt deposits), efflorescence, water infiltration, or loose bricks. These issues can compromise the safety and durability of the structure, leading to further damage if not properly addressed. Homeowners may notice water leaks, mold growth, or a significant decline in the appearance of their brickwork, prompting the need for professional restoration work to prevent further deterioration and maintain the property's value.

The overview below groups typical Brick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bronx, NY.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or brick restoration projects, such as fixing cracked or chipped bricks,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and labor involved.

Surface Cleaning - Professional brick cleaning services in Bronx and nearby areas usually cost between $300 and $1,200. Larger or more heavily stained surfaces can push costs toward the higher end of this range.

Repointing and Tuckpointing - Repointing work, which involves replacing mortar between bricks, often costs between $1,000 and $3,500 for typical projects. Larger, more complex jobs may reach $4,500 or more, though most projects stay within the middle of this spectrum.

Full Brick Replacement - Complete replacement of damaged or deteriorated bricks can range from $2,500 to $8,000 or higher for extensive work. Many projects fall into the lower to mid-range, with larger projects representing a smaller percentage of total jobs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of brick restoration services are available? Local contractors can handle a variety of brick restoration tasks including cleaning, repointing, repairing damaged bricks, and restoring historic brickwork to preserve its appearance and structural integrity.

How can brick restoration improve the appearance of my property? Professional brick restoration can enhance curb appeal by cleaning and repairing worn or damaged bricks, making the building look well-maintained and aesthetically appealing.

Are there specific signs that indicate my brickwork needs restoration? Signs such as crumbling mortar, cracked or spalling bricks, efflorescence, or water infiltration are common indicators that brick restoration services may be needed.

What methods do local contractors use for brick cleaning? They often use gentle cleaning techniques like low-pressure washing or specialized chemical solutions to remove dirt, stains, and biological growth without damaging the brick surface.
